  • Patent number: 11319017
    Abstract: A hydraulic braking system for a bicycle may include a hydraulic control device that is configured with multiple timing ports positioned within a stroke of a piston of the hydraulic control device. The multiple timing ports are located at different positions along an operational and/or axial length of a cylinder of the hydraulic control device.

  • Patent number: 10501144
    Abstract: A lever assembly for a bicycle may be adjustable. The lever assembly may include an anchoring member, a rod coupled to the anchoring member, and a retaining device applying a clamping force to the anchoring member. The retaining device may include a first extension and a second extension configured to obstruct rotation of the rod about a longitudinal axis of the rod.

  • Patent number: 9290232
    Abstract: A brake assembly for a hydraulic brake system of a handlebar-steered vehicle, the brake assembly including a housing mountable to a handlebar of the vehicle and having a chamber formed therein. The brake assembly is provided with a variable rate linkage. A piston assembly is received and axially guided within the chamber and is provided with a piston adjustment mechanism that does not affect the function of the variable rate linkage.
